Neymar’s Warning to Brazil Stars at Real Madrid About Kylian Mbappe

Brazilian forward Neymar Jr has reportedly warned his Brazil teammates at Real Madrid about playing alongside Kylian Mbappe. Neymar and Mbappe played together at Paris Saint-Germain (PSG) for five years, where their relationship was often under scrutiny. Neymar’s departure from PSG this summer to join Al-Hilal in Saudi Arabia stirred further speculation about the tension between the two stars.

According to journalist Cyril Hanouna, Neymar expressed concerns to his fellow Brazilians at Real Madrid, where Mbappe has recently transferred. Hanouna claims that Neymar described his time playing with Mbappe as “catastrophic” and likened it to being “hell,” offering a stern warning to those now sharing the dressing room with the French star.

Neymar and Mbappe’s Time at PSG: A Complex Partnership

Neymar and Mbappe formed a formidable duo at PSG, playing together in 136 matches and combining for 54 joint goal contributions across various competitions. Despite their success on the field, reports of tension between the two frequently surfaced, especially in the final years of Neymar’s time in Paris. This rift reportedly played a role in Neymar’s eventual departure from the club.

While the duo often dazzled with their technical brilliance and attacking prowess, rumors of clashing egos and differences in playing style were never far behind. With Neymar now in Saudi Arabia, and Mbappe taking on a more prominent leadership role at PSG, the Brazilian’s recent comments have reignited discussions about the true nature of their relationship.

Cyril Hanouna’s Revelations: A Warning to Real Madrid’s Brazilians

Journalist Cyril Hanouna shared shocking details during a Europe Goal 1 interview, where he revealed that Neymar had communicated directly with his friends at Real Madrid, including fellow Brazilians Vinicius Jr, Rodrygo, and Éder Militão. According to Hanouna, Neymar’s message was clear: playing alongside Mbappe is not as harmonious as it may seem.

“Neymar told them that it was a constant battle, a war. He sent a paper to the Brazilians, warning them that it was catastrophic, that it was hell,” Hanouna reported. These statements highlight the intensity of Neymar’s grievances, suggesting that the Brazilian’s experience playing with Mbappe was far from positive. The Real Madrid Brazilians, now set to form new bonds with Mbappe, may face challenges similar to those Neymar encountered during his time in Paris.
